本文目录导读:
图片来源于网络,如有侵权联系删除
随着云计算技术的飞速发展,云服务器已成为众多企业、个人用户的首选,如何确保云服务器的稳定性和高性能,成为用户关注的焦点,本文将从多个角度,详细解析如何测试云服务器的性能,帮助用户选择合适的云服务器。
云服务器性能测试方法
1、基本性能测试
(1)CPU性能测试:使用CPU-Z等工具检测云服务器的CPU型号、核心数、主频等信息,通过FPU运算测试、多线程测试等,评估CPU的运算能力和稳定性。
(2)内存性能测试:使用内存检测工具,如Memtest86+,检测云服务器的内存容量、速度、稳定性等,通过内存拷贝测试、内存带宽测试等,评估内存的性能。
(3)硬盘性能测试:使用CrystalDiskMark等工具,检测云服务器的硬盘读写速度、IOPS等指标,通过4K随机读写测试、大文件读写测试等,评估硬盘的性能。
2、应用性能测试
(1)网络性能测试:使用网络测试工具,如Iperf、JMeter等,测试云服务器的网络带宽、延迟、丢包率等指标,通过压力测试、并发测试等,评估网络性能。
图片来源于网络,如有侵权联系删除
(2)数据库性能测试:使用数据库性能测试工具,如MySQL Workbench、Oracle SQL Developer等,测试云服务器的数据库读写速度、并发能力等,通过TPC-C、TPC-H等测试,评估数据库性能。
(3)Web性能测试:使用Web性能测试工具,如Apache JMeter、LoadRunner等,测试云服务器的Web服务器性能,通过并发测试、压力测试等,评估Web性能。
3、系统稳定性测试
(1)长时间运行测试:让云服务器长时间运行,观察是否存在系统崩溃、死机等现象,评估系统的稳定性。
(2)负载测试:模拟大量用户访问云服务器,观察系统性能是否受到影响,评估系统的负载能力。
(3)故障恢复测试:模拟硬件故障、软件故障等,观察云服务器的故障恢复能力,评估系统的可靠性。
云服务器性能测试技巧
1、选择合适的测试工具:根据测试需求,选择合适的性能测试工具,如CPU-Z、Memtest86+、CrystalDiskMark等。
图片来源于网络,如有侵权联系删除
2、制定合理的测试方案:根据云服务器的配置和需求,制定合理的测试方案,包括测试项目、测试指标、测试时间等。
3、重视测试环境:测试环境应尽量与实际应用环境相似,确保测试结果的准确性。
4、分析测试数据:对测试数据进行详细分析,找出性能瓶颈,为优化云服务器性能提供依据。
5、定期进行测试:定期对云服务器进行性能测试,确保系统稳定运行。
云服务器性能测试是保障系统稳定性和高性能的关键环节,通过以上方法,用户可以全面了解云服务器的性能表现,为选择合适的云服务器提供参考,在实际应用中,还需根据具体需求,不断优化和调整测试方案,确保云服务器性能满足预期。
标签: #如何测试云服务器
评论列表